Description:

This person will be responsible for daily oversight of the supplies in the invasive areas within St. Peters hospital.

Position verifies and receives par, requester, and capital orders for OR, IR. EP, and Cath Lab areas and works with requesters with questions and order logistics. Will also support the new QSight processes in IR, EP, and Cath Lab.

Requirements:      

Associate degree preferred     

Supply chain/Materials Management healthcare experience recommended

Must be able to do heavy lifting
